Green Isles Take Steps Towards Peace, Open Their Borders
By Paulan Jayse

King Alexander confronts Alhazred at the former vizier's trial.

Abdul Alhazred, former Vizier to King Caliphim of the Land of the Green Isles, was convicted today on two counts of murder in the first degree, one count of high treason, two counts of attempted murder, and several lesser crimes stemming from his service to the country. Deliberations lasted only one hour, unusually short for crimes of this magnitude. When the jury announced its verdict, Alhazred merely narrowed his eyes and glared menacingly at each juror. Cheers arose from the gallery, forcing the tribunal to call for order. After the verdict was read, the judge asked Alhazred if he had anything to say. The former vizier turned to King Alexander, the prosecuting attorney, and

said, “You will rue the day that you crossed Abdul Alhazred. There is no prison that can hold me! One day soon you and all the world will be at my mercy!”

Following Alhazred’s statements, the tribunal announced a sentence of life imprisonment, and ordered Captain Saladin to remove the defendant from the courtroom. Alahzred will be held for a short time in his cell in the Castle of the Crown before being transferred to an undisclosed loation for the remainder of his sentence.
